
Paperback
Published 13 Aug 2012
- $13.80
16 results
Paperback
Published 13 Aug 2012
$5.47off
Hardback
Published 15 Mar 2023
Save $5.47
$2.70off
Paperback
Published 15 Mar 2023
Save $2.70
Paperback
Published 25 Mar 2006
Paperback
Published 31 Jan 1979
Paperback
Published 01 Jan 1994
Paperback
Published 30 May 1992
Paperback
Published 01 Nov 1994
Hardback
Paperback
Published 31 Jan 1988
Book
Published 01 Jan 1986
Book
Published 01 Jan 1990
Paperback
Published 01 Jan 1991
Book
Published 01 Jan 1982
Paperback
|
Spanish
Published 15 May 2020